В Птн, 09.07.2004, в 20:24, Alvaro Herrera пишет: > On Fri, Jul 09, 2004 at 07:16:14PM +0200, Markus Bertheau wrote: > > > why does everyone write > > > > CREATE FUNCTION foo() RETURNS INTEGER AS ' > > blah blah > > ' LANGUAGE 'plpgsql'; > > > > I've never seen for example: > > > > CREATE FUNCTION foo() > > RETURNS INTEGER > > LANGUAGE 'plpgsql' > > AS ' > > blah blah > > '; > > > > Is there a special reason to this? I have a hard time believing that > > everyone does it the same way by coincidence. > > I think previous versions only allowed the language specification at the > end. I got used to putting it before the function text though, so if > you are able to read something written by me you'd see that. > > That was your point, wasn't it? Yes, it was.
